Step 2: Set Up a Self-Custody Wallet – MetaMask

To buy BTT, you’ll need a non-custodial wallet that gives you direct control over your private keys and enables interaction with decentralized exchanges. MetaMask is one of the most user-friendly and widely adopted wallets for this purpose.

Available as a browser extension and mobile app, MetaMask supports Ethereum and EVM-compatible blockchains—making it ideal for swapping ETH into BTT.

How to Create a MetaMask Wallet in 9 Steps

  1. Download MetaMask from the official website or app store (browser extension or mobile app).
  2. Click "Get Started" to begin setup.
  3. Select "Create a Wallet".
  4. Agree to the terms of service.
  5. Set a strong password to protect your wallet.
  6. Back up your 12-word recovery phrase in a secure, offline location—this is crucial for recovering your wallet if you lose access.
  7. Confirm your seed phrase when prompted.
  8. Name your wallet account (e.g., “Primary” or “Trading”).
  9. Finish setup and view your wallet address.

Your MetaMask wallet is now active and ready for use.

🔐 Security Tip: Never share your seed phrase with anyone. No legitimate service will ever ask for it.

Once your wallet is set up, you can receive ETH from your exchange and begin trading on decentralized platforms.


Step 3: Transfer ETH to MetaMask and Connect to a Decentralized Exchange

Now that your MetaMask wallet is ready, it’s time to transfer your ETH from the exchange.

How to Transfer ETH to MetaMask

  1. In your exchange account, go to the withdrawal or "Send" section.
  2. Choose ETH as the withdrawal currency.
  3. Select the appropriate network (ensure it matches the network supported by your MetaMask—usually Ethereum Mainnet).
  4. Paste your MetaMask wallet address as the recipient.
  5. Confirm the transaction and pay the associated gas fee.

Wait a few minutes for the transaction to confirm on the blockchain. Once received, your ETH balance will appear in MetaMask.

Why Can’t You Swap Directly in MetaMask?

While MetaMask offers an in-wallet swap feature, it only facilitates trades between tokens on the same blockchain. Since BTT exists primarily on the TRON network and certain EVM chains like BitTorrent Chain, a direct ETH-to-BTT swap may not be supported natively within MetaMask’s interface.

Therefore, you’ll need to use a decentralized exchange (DEX) that lists BTT or supports manual token addition via smart contract.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Can I buy BitTorrent (BTT) directly with fiat currency?

Most major exchanges do not offer direct fiat-to-BTT pairs. However, you can buy ETH with EUR or USD and then swap it for BTT on a decentralized exchange.

Is BTT available on Ethereum?

Yes, BTT has an ERC-20 version available on the Ethereum blockchain, though its primary chain is TRON due to scalability and lower transaction costs.

What is the safest way to buy BTT?

The safest method involves using a trusted exchange to buy ETH, transferring it securely to your MetaMask wallet, and swapping on a reputable DEX after verifying the token contract.

Why isn’t BTT listed on every exchange?

BTT is a utility token focused on decentralized file sharing rather than speculative trading. As such, it may not meet listing criteria on all platforms, especially those prioritizing high-volume assets.

How do I store BTT safely after purchase?

Store BTT in a non-custodial wallet like MetaMask, Trust Wallet, or Ledger. Avoid leaving tokens on exchanges long-term to reduce risk of theft or platform failure.

Can I stake or earn rewards with BTT?

Yes—BTT is used within the BitTorrent ecosystem to incentivize seeding, bandwidth sharing, and participation in decentralized services. Some platforms also offer staking or yield opportunities for BTT holders.
